What is Web Handling Automation?

Web handling automation controls how continuous roll materials, such as film, foil, paper, and textiles, move through a process. It manages tension, alignment, splicing, and inspection so the web runs smoothly at speed without wrinkles, breaks, or waste.

From Single-Zone Control to Fully Coordinated Web Lines

The right control depends on your material, line speed, and quality targets. We build across the full range:

Single-zone tension control stabilizes one section of the process.

Multi-zone control coordinates tension and tracking across the full line.

Fully integrated web lines add splicing, inspection, and registration for continuous, high-quality running.

What is web tension control?

Web tension control uses sensors and drives to hold the web at a consistent tension as it moves. Correct tension prevents wrinkles, stretching, and breaks, which protects quality and reduces scrap.

What materials count as a web?

A web is any continuous, flexible material processed from a roll, including plastic film, foil, paper, nonwovens, textiles, and thin metal. Each behaves differently and needs tuned handling.

How does web handling reduce waste?

Stable tension and accurate tracking prevent wrinkles, misalignment, and breaks that create scrap and downtime. Inspection catches defects early so bad material is not converted or shipped.
